The Technical Dimension: Replacing Pistons with Electromagnets
At the core of this conversion is a fundamental shift in technology. A traditional gas engine is a complex marvel of controlled explosions, with hundreds of moving parts like pistons, valves, and crankshafts working in a violent but effective symphony. It is powerful but inherently inefficient, losing significant energy to heat and friction.
In contrast, an electric brushless motor, or BLDC motor, is a model of elegant simplicity. Its principle is based on electromagnetism. A controller sends precise electrical currents to copper windings in the stationary part (the stator), creating a rotating magnetic field. This field interacts with magnets on the rotating part (the rotor), generating powerful, smooth, and direct rotational force.
Why Choose a Brushless Motor?
- Efficiency:Brushless motors can be over 90% efficient, meaning more power from your battery is converted directly into wheel-spinning torque. A gas engine often struggles to reach 35% efficiency.
- Low Maintenance:With no oil to change, spark plugs to replace, or valves to adjust, the maintenance schedule becomes incredibly simple. The lack of friction-heavy components means a significantly longer operational lifespan.
- Instant Response:Unlike a gas engine that needs to build revs, a brushless motor delivers maximum torque from a standstill. This results in startlingly quick acceleration and a responsive throttle that feels directly connected to your will.
Core Upgrade Components
The conversion hinges on a few key components working in harmony. A typical high-performance kit includes a powerful motor like the Kunray KR5V, a sophisticated controller from a brand like Fardriver, a robust battery system, and an adapted drivetrain. The controller acts as the brain, interpreting throttle input and managing the flow of energy from the battery to the motor. The battery and its associated Battery Management System (BMS) are the fuel tank, determining range and power output. Finally, the chain system must be properly sized to handle the instant torque of the electric powertrain.

The Economic Dimension: Cost-Benefit Analysis
While there is an upfront investment in an electric conversion kit, the long-term economic benefits are substantial. Consider it a shift from a model of continuous expenses to one of long-term savings.
One-Time Investment vs. Long-Term Savings:
- Fuel Costs:The cost of charging a motorcycle battery is a fraction of the cost of filling a gas tank. Depending on your local electricity and gas prices, you could save up to 90% on "fuel" costs per mile.
- Maintenance Costs:Say goodbye to regular oil changes, filter replacements, spark plugs, and expensive engine tune-ups. The savings on parts and labor over several years can easily offset a significant portion of the initial conversion cost.
Furthermore, many governments and local municipalities offer tax credits or rebates for converting a vehicle to electric power, further sweetening the financial proposition. The User Experience Dimension: Redefining Performance
This is where the conversion truly shines. The riding experience of an electric motorcycle is profoundly different—and for many, profoundly better.
The most noticeable change is the power delivery. The instant torque provides a thrilling, seamless wave of acceleration from a complete stop. There is no clutch to manage, no gears to shift, and no power band to chase. Just smooth, linear, and silent speed. The lack of engine vibration creates a serene, almost gliding sensation, allowing you to hear the world around you and feel more connected to the road.
Modern controllers also bring a new level of customization. Many kits come with controllers that can be programmed via a smartphone app. This allows you to fine-tune your riding experience, adjusting acceleration curves, setting top speed limits, and controlling the level of regenerative braking, which uses the motor to slow the bike down while recapturing energy for the battery. This is a level of control that gasoline engines simply cannot offer.
The Practical Dimension: Your DIY Conversion Roadmap
Undertaking the conversion yourself is a rewarding challenge. With careful planning and the right tools, it is an achievable project for any competent home mechanic.
Preparation is Key:
Before you begin, gather your tools: a solid set of wrenches and sockets, wire cutters and crimpers, a multimeter for electrical checks, and potentially some basic fabrication tools for mounting brackets.
The Conversion Process in Brief:
- Deconstruction:Carefully remove the gasoline engine, exhaust system, fuel tank, and related components. This stage is about creating a clean slate.
- Motor Installation:This is the most critical mechanical step. You may need to fabricate or adapt mounting brackets to securely fit the new electric motor into the frame, ensuring proper chain alignment.
- Component Placement:Strategically mount the controller and battery pack. The goal is to keep the center of gravity low and balanced for optimal handling and safety.
- Wiring and Connection:This requires precision. Connect the battery to the controller, the controller to the motor, and wire in the throttle, on/off switch, and any monitoring displays. Always follow wiring diagrams meticulously.
- Tuning and Testing:With everything connected, you can program the controller to set your desired performance parameters. Start with low power settings for initial tests before unleashing the full potential.
